Glades Day had to endure a four-game losing streak, but that streak is no more. They came out on top against the Clewiston Tigers by a score of 18-14 on Wednesday. The win was just what Glades Day needed coming off of a 19-4 loss in their prior match.
For Clewiston's part, Liani Ricco was cooking despite her team's loss, scoring three runs and stealing two bases while getting on base in four of her five plate appearances. The team also got some help courtesy of Olivia Branaman, who scored two runs and stole a base while going 4-for-4.
Even though they lost, Clewiston kept the outfield on their toes and finished the game with 17 hits. That's the most hits they've managed all season.
Glades Day's victory bumped their record up to 4-8. As for Clewiston, they dropped their record down to 1-13 with that defeat, which was their eighth straight on the road dating back to last season.
Glades Day will be playing at home against Okeechobee at 4:30 p.m. on Monday. As for Clewiston, they will head out on the road to challenge Cardinal Newman at 4:30 p.m. on Monday.
